Hybrid heuristic algorithm for multi-objective scheduling problem

被引:9
|
作者
Peng Jian'gang [1 ]
Liu Mingzhou [1 ]
Zhang Xi [1 ]
Ling Lin [1 ]
机构
[1] Hefei Univ Technol, Sch Mech Engn, Hefei 230009, Anhui, Peoples R China
关键词
flexible job-shop scheduling; harmony search (HS) algorithm; Pareto optimality; opposition-based learning; PARTICLE SWARM OPTIMIZATION; HARMONY SEARCH ALGORITHM; GENETIC ALGORITHM; EVOLUTIONARY ALGORITHMS; PARETO-OPTIMALITY; SHOP;
D O I
10.21629/JSEE.2019.02.12
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
This research provides academic and practical contributions. From a theoretical standpoint, a hybrid harmony search (HS) algorithm, namely the oppositional global-based HS (OGHS), is proposed for solving the multi-objective flexible job-shop scheduling problems (MOFJSPs) to minimize makespan, total machine workload and critical machine workload. An initialization program embedded in opposition-based learning (OBL) is developed for enabling the individuals to scatter in a well-distributed manner in the initial harmony memory (HM). In addition, the recursive halving technique based on opposite number is employed for shrinking the neighbourhood space in the searching phase of the OGHS. From a practice-related standpoint, a type of dual vector code technique is introduced for allowing the OGHS algorithm to adapt the discrete nature of the MOFJSP. Two practical techniques, namely Pareto optimality and technique for order preference by similarity to an ideal solution (TOPSIS), are implemented for solving the MOFJSP. Furthermore, the algorithm performance is tested by using different strategies, including OBL and recursive halving, and the OGHS is compared with existing algorithms in the latest studies. Experimental results on representative examples validate the performance of the proposed algorithm for solving the MOFJSP.
引用
收藏
页码:327 / 342
页数:16
相关论文
共 50 条
  • [41] Improved NSGA-II Algorithm for Multi-objective Scheduling Problem in Hybrid Flow Shop
    Han, Zhonghua
    Wang, Shiyao
    Dong, Xiaoting
    Ma, Xiaofu
    [J]. 2017 9TH INTERNATIONAL CONFERENCE ON MODELLING, IDENTIFICATION AND CONTROL (ICMIC 2017), 2017, : 740 - 745
  • [42] A hybrid genetic-gravitational search algorithm for a multi-objective flow shop scheduling problem
    Lee, T. S.
    Loong, Y. T.
    Tan, S. C.
    [J]. INTERNATIONAL JOURNAL OF INDUSTRIAL ENGINEERING COMPUTATIONS, 2019, 10 (03) : 331 - 348
  • [43] Multi-objective scheduling problem: Hybrid approach using fuzzy assisted cuckoo search algorithm
    Chandrasekaran, K.
    Simon, Sishaj P.
    [J]. SWARM AND EVOLUTIONARY COMPUTATION, 2012, 5 : 1 - 16
  • [44] Scheduling multi-objective open shop scheduling using a hybrid immune algorithm
    Naderi, B.
    Mousakhani, M.
    Khalili, M.
    [J]. IN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2013, 66 (5-8): : 895 - 905
  • [45] A multi-objective electromagnetism algorithm for a bi-objective flowshop scheduling problem
    Khalili, Majid
    Tavakkoli-Moghaddam, Reza
    [J]. JOURNAL OF MANUFACTURING SYSTEMS, 2012, 31 (02) : 232 - 239
  • [46] Application of multi-objective memetic algorithm in multi-objective flexible job-shop scheduling problem
    Zhenwen, H.U.
    [J]. Academic Journal of Manufacturing Engineering, 2019, 17 (03): : 24 - 28
  • [47] A Hybrid Differential Evolution Algorithm for the Multi-objective Reentrant Job-shop Scheduling Problem
    Qian, B.
    Li, Z. H.
    Hu, R.
    Zhang, C. S.
    [J]. 2013 10TH IEEE INTERNATIONAL CONFERENCE ON CONTROL AND AUTOMATION (ICCA), 2013, : 485 - 489
  • [48] Multi-objective assembly permutation flow shop scheduling problem: a mathematical model and a meta-heuristic algorithm
    Tajbakhsh, Zahra
    Fattahi, Parviz
    Behnamian, Javad
    [J]. JOURNAL OF THE OPERATIONAL RESEARCH SOCIETY, 2014, 65 (10) : 1580 - 1592
  • [49] A NEW HYBRID HEURISTIC ALGORITHM FOR THE MULTI OBJECTIVE FACILITY LAYOUT PROBLEM
    Sahin, Ramazan
    Turkbey, Orhan
    [J]. JOURNAL OF THE FACULTY OF ENGINEERING AND ARCHITECTURE OF GAZI UNIVERSITY, 2010, 25 (01): : 119 - 130
  • [50] A Heuristic for Multi-Objective Chinese Postman Problem
    Prakash, Satya
    Sharma, Mahesh K.
    Singh, Amarinder
    [J]. CIE: 2009 INTERNATIONAL CONFERENCE ON COMPUTERS AND INDUSTRIAL ENGINEERING, VOLS 1-3, 2009, : 596 - +